I recently tried a burner mission. It didn't last long and it wasn't pretty but it gave me an idea: PVP training missions.

Now, before you jump in and say "but it's an MMO", my personal circumstances mean that I can rarely devote an extended period of uninterrupted time to EVE so as much as I'd like to do small gang PVP, chances are I have to bail at some point.

But that's by the by. This could be for someone who

- is waiting for their mates to come on line
- wants to try out a new module and wants a bit more of a challenge than a regular PVE mission
- is a newbie who wants to try a few moves without losing ship after ship
- is not a newbie who wants to practice a certain move over and over without boring their mates

It's basically a practice mission.

The idea is to have Aura training missions from level 1 to 4 that are available in any station (or not) that will spawn a single ship that behaves in the same way as a burner but DOES NOT kill but instead warps away if the capsuleer is taken down to 10% structure (or something like that).

Like I said, I know this is an MMO and so group play should be encouraged and I know that you learn much more from other people than you do on your own but it's an idea and I think it may be helpful and after all there is nothing stopping a small group taking one of these missions to practice tactics together without fear of ship loss.
